#######################################
|
|
# Removes secrets securely before 'lb build' execution.
|
|
# Globals:
|
|
# BASH_SOURCE
|
|
# VAR_TMP_SECRET
|
|
# Arguments:
|
|
# None
|
|
# Returns:
|
|
# 0: on success
|
|
#######################################
|
|
x_remove() {
|
|
declare luks_key_filename="${VAR_LUKS_KEY:-luks.txt}" luks_key_path="" signing_pass_path=""
|
|
declare -a find_args=("${VAR_TMP_SECRET}" -xdev -type f)
|
|
|
|
printf "\e[95m🧪 %s starting ... \e[0m\n" "${BASH_SOURCE[0]}"
|
|
|
|
validate_secret_staging_area || return "${ERR_SECRET_PATH}"
|
|
|
|
if [[ "${VAR_SIGNER}" == "true" ]]; then
|
|
validate_secret_file_in_root "${VAR_SIGNING_KEY_PASS}" "signing passphrase file" || return "${ERR_SECRET_PATH}"
|
|
signing_pass_path="${VAR_TMP_SECRET}/${VAR_SIGNING_KEY_PASS}"
|
|
find_args+=(! -path "${signing_pass_path}")
|
|
fi
|
|
|
|
validate_secret_file_in_root "${luks_key_filename}" "LUKS key file" || return "${ERR_SECRET_PATH}"
|
|
luks_key_path="${VAR_TMP_SECRET}/${luks_key_filename}"
|
|
find_args+=(! -path "${luks_key_path}")
|
|
|
|
# shellcheck disable=SC2312
|
|
find "${find_args[@]}" -print0 | xargs -0 --no-run-if-empty shred -fzu -n 5 --
|
|
find "${VAR_TMP_SECRET}" -xdev -depth -type d -empty -delete
|
|
|
|
printf "\e[92m✅ %s successfully applied. \e[0m\n" "${BASH_SOURCE[0]}"
|
|
|
|
return 0
|
|
}
|
|
### Prevents accidental 'unset -f'.
|
|
# shellcheck disable=SC2034
|
|
readonly -f x_remove
